【转】ASP.NET WEB API系列教程

简介: from: 西瓜小强 http://www.cnblogs.com/risk/category/406988.html    ASP.NET Web API教程(六) 安全与身份认证 摘要: 在实际的项目应用中,很多时候都需要保证数据的安全和可靠,如何来保证数据的安全呢?做法有很多,最常见的就是进行身份验证。

from: 西瓜小强 http://www.cnblogs.com/risk/category/406988.html 

 

摘要: 在实际的项目应用中,很多时候都需要保证数据的安全和可靠,如何来保证数据的安全呢?做法有很多,最常见的就是进行身份验证。验证通过,根据验证过的身份给与对应访问权限。同在Web Api中如何实现身份认证呢?接下来的内容就详细的分享 Web API身份认证。首先扩展自定义身份验证添加类 CustomA... 阅读全文
posted @  2012-08-29 09:49 西瓜小强 阅读(12477) |  评论 (15)  编辑
 
摘要: 如何使用web api 保证数据的有效性?实际项目中不是什么数据提交过来都是符合要求的,况且在天朝还有N多河蟹的关键字等等。所以以下内容就是增加web api 数据验证.第一步修改 实体模型 public classUserInfo { public intId{ get; s... 阅读全文
posted @  2012-08-28 11:05 西瓜小强 阅读(4613) |  评论 (0)  编辑
 
摘要: 看过前三篇文章的朋友,应该对Asp.net Web api 有个初步的了解,起码了解了web api的编码方式。那么这一篇就分享一下web api中的分页。话不多说,直接上硬货。 接下来的内容都是在上一篇中的扩展,所以找不到的资料可以从上一篇中下载到。 首先增加支持分页的API方法 publi... 阅读全文
posted @  2012-08-27 10:57 西瓜小强 阅读(5147) |  评论 (6)  编辑
 
摘要: 上一篇中已经介绍了如何获取数据,这一篇就直接分享增删改。第一步增加方法Bll中增加 public UserInfo Add(UserInfo user) { var tempId = Data.OrderByDescending(j => j.Id).First().Id + ... 阅读全文
posted @  2012-08-24 16:52 西瓜小强 阅读(5855) |  评论 (5)  编辑
 
摘要: 书接上文,打开上一个文章中的项目。(可以从上一个文章中下载到 ASP.NET Web API教程(一) 你的第一个Web API )添加类库项目 Entities添加用户实体 public classUserInfo { public intId{ get; set;} ... 阅读全文
posted @  2012-08-22 14:17 西瓜小强 阅读(6491) |  评论 (1)  编辑
 
摘要: ASP.NET Web API 是一个框架,使用它能够非常容易的构建基于HTTP协议的服务。达到广泛的客户端使用。包括浏览器和移动设备.ASP.NET WEB API 是一个理想的平台门用于构建RESTful应用程序的网络框架。 接下来就开始来创建第一个Web API 第一步 获取MVC4支持,以... 阅读全文
 
 
 
 
目录
相关文章
|
1月前
|
JSON API 数据库
解释如何在 Python 中实现 Web 服务(RESTful API)。
解释如何在 Python 中实现 Web 服务(RESTful API)。
23 0
|
2月前
|
IDE Java API
使用Java Web技术构建RESTful API的实践指南
使用Java Web技术构建RESTful API的实践指南
|
25天前
|
开发框架 .NET 物联网
.NET从入门到精通,零基础也能搞定的基础知识教程
.NET从入门到精通,零基础也能搞定的基础知识教程
19 0
|
1月前
|
XML JSON API
通过Flask框架创建灵活的、可扩展的Web Restful API服务
通过Flask框架创建灵活的、可扩展的Web Restful API服务
|
1月前
|
缓存 监控 API
Python Web框架FastAPI——一个比Flask和Tornada更高性能的API框架
Python Web框架FastAPI——一个比Flask和Tornada更高性能的API框架
57 0
|
1月前
|
JSON API 数据格式
构建高效Python Web应用:Flask框架与RESTful API设计实践
【2月更文挑战第17天】在现代Web开发中,轻量级框架与RESTful API设计成为了提升应用性能和可维护性的关键。本文将深入探讨如何使用Python的Flask框架来构建高效的Web服务,并通过具体实例分析RESTful API的设计原则及其实现过程。我们将从基本的应用架构出发,逐步介绍如何利用Flask的灵活性进行模块化开发,并结合请求处理、数据验证以及安全性考虑,打造出一个既符合标准又易于扩展的Web应用。
628 4
|
2月前
|
前端开发 JavaScript API
前端秘法番外篇----学完Web API,前端才能算真正的入门
前端秘法番外篇----学完Web API,前端才能算真正的入门
|
2月前
|
API 网络架构
解释 RESTful API,以及如何使用它构建 web 应用程序。
解释 RESTful API,以及如何使用它构建 web 应用程序。
87 0
|
2月前
|
存储 前端开发 搜索推荐
前端开发中值得关注的三个Web API
【2月更文挑战第4天】Web API是前端开发中非常重要的一部分,它们为开发者提供了众多的功能和特性,帮助我们构建更加高效、优美的Web应用。本文将介绍三个值得关注的Web API,包括Web Storage、Geolocation和Web Notifications,希望能够对前端开发者有所帮助。
|
2月前
|
缓存 安全 API
深入理解Web开发中的RESTful API设计
在当今快速演进的技术世界中,RESTful API已成为构建现代Web应用不可或缺的一部分。它不仅促进了前后端的分离发展,还为不同平台间的数据交换提供了一种高效、标准化的方式。本文旨在深入探讨RESTful API的设计原则和最佳实践,通过具体示例说明如何设计易于维护、可扩展和安全的API。我们将从REST的基本概念出发,逐步深入到资源命名、HTTP方法的恰当使用、状态码的选择、以及安全性考虑等方面,为读者提供一个全面而深入的视角,帮助大家更好地理解和运用RESTful API。

热门文章

最新文章